bought a blueberry bush from this company a couple of months back, finally a couple of dead twigs arrived at the weekend. Tried contacting them by email and had no reponse. Their 0870 contact number keeps you on hold, so I tried thier bath number (01225 486000) yesterday. They said they would get straight back to me. Tried again today and have been promised they would contact their suppliers as it their suppliers problem. I just want my money back. Completly rubbish customer service. Wont buy witht thm again.

Just a suggestion, but are you sure it is not just a dormant plant? Plants ship better in their dormant state and are less prone to transplant shock. It would certainly look like dead twigs at the dormant stage.0
